1. SEISMIC SURVEY 14 JAN THRU 01 APR BY S/V GEOLOG DMITRI NALIVKIN AND M/V RAMFORM EXPLORER TOWING EIGHT THREE MILE LONG CABLES IN AREAS: A. BOUND BY 04-07N 003-18E, 04-24N 003-14E, 04-24N 002-39E, 04-07N 002-39E. B. BETWEEN 04-24N 002-43E AND 04-51N 002-20E. WIDE BERTH REQUESTED. 2. CANCEL THIS MSG 02 APR.
